AN ACT relating to public procurement. [HB-114] [Trade ] [Manufacturing ] [Construction ] [Economic Development ] [Funding ] [Public Safety ]
Create new sections of KRS Chapter 45A to set forth findings of the General Assembly and establish a policy of the Commonwealth of Kentucky to promote the Kentucky and United States economies by requiring a preference for iron, steel, and manufactured goods produced in Kentucky and the United States; define "manufactured in Kentucky," "manufactured in the United States," and "United States"; require preference for iron, steel, and manufactured goods made in Kentucky in construction and maintenance contracts and subcontracts; provide for a waiver (continued...)

AN ACT relating to blockchain technology. [SB-55] [Technology and Innovation ]
Create a new section of KRS Chapter 42 to create a six-member Blockchain Technology Working Group; attach the working group to the Commonwealth Office of Technology; require the working group to examine the applicability of blockchain technology for various utility sectors and report to the Governor and the LRC by December 1 of each year.

Relating To Public Works. [HB-831] [Housing ] [Labor, Jobs, Employment ] [Construction ]
Increases from $500,000 to $5,000,000 the cost threshold for an experimental and demonstration housing developed by the counties or housing developed by the Hawaii Housing Finance and Development Corporation to be exempted from the wages and hours laws for public works.

Gas Companies - Rate Regulation - Environmental Remediation Costs [HB-414] [Energy ] [Environmental ] [Public Health ] [Water ]
Authorizing the Public Service Commission, when determining specified expenses while setting a just and reasonable rate for a gas company, to include all costs reasonably incurred by the gas company for performing environmental remediation of real property in response to a State or federal law, regulation, or order under specified conditions; authorizing that specified environmental remediation costs be included in a gas company's specified expenses regardless of specified circumstances; etc.
